BranchReaper deletes branches inactive past the threshold, excluding protected and release-prefixed branches. Runs nightly in prod only; dry-run everywhere else. Before a release freeze, confirm the freeze flag is set, otherwise the bot may delete backport branches mid-train. If a branch is reaped in error, restore from the reflog mirror within 14 days. Escalate repeated false positives to the Toolsmith rotation. Do not modify thresholds directly in the UI; changes go through config review. Current operating values are listed below.

deployment values, yahag-tawef:
ZORWYN_HOST=zorwyn.tolvaqlabs.internal
ZORWYN_PORT=9300

## Account Recovery — StageGrid Seat-Map Renderer

If the release account for StageGrid is locked after a failed deploy, do not create a new publisher identity; this orphans the Velvetine Theatre seat-map bundles. Instead, open the recovery console, select the renderer's service account, and verify the last two successful build hashes with the duty engineer. Once both hashes match, the console will prompt for the recovery passphrase shown below.

strongbox words: sorir-belvan-rusix-ulays-ralmir-praix-eliir-tamax-praael-druael-julir-tamius-jorir

Handover — records team
Mira: Pellwick Express missed yesterday's 14:00 pick-up, no call-ahead. I've cancelled the contract run and booked Ostler Freight for tomorrow, 10:30, dock B. Same crate, same seals — don't re-pack. Manifest copy is in the grey tray. New driver won't have the old paperwork, so brief them at the door. Pass them the following instruction verbatim.

courier memo of yawep-yafog: the pramir ulaix courier leaves the ulavan aldix frair zorok oliiel joreth rusdor fenvan ledger at gate 1305 under passcode 514738

# Env file — Cartwheel dispatch, driver-assignment heuristic
# Scope: staging only. Do not promote to prod.
# The heuristic weights (proximity, shift balance, refusal rate) are tuned
# for the Velmont pilot region and will misbehave elsewhere.
# Review notes: heuristic service runs unprivileged; it reads weights
# read-only from the tuning store and writes nothing back.
# Only one sensitive value exists in this file: the tuning-store access
# credential, consumed at boot and never logged.
# That credential is set on the following line.

secret setting of faduf-bahop: LEDGER_TOKEN8=c3b363be